Lumirithmic is an Imperial College London spin‑out building camera AI, custom vision models, 3D facial capture systems and neural rendering pipelines. Our technology is trusted by Magnificent 7 companies, global beauty brands and mobile OEMs. We hold 8 patents in the space and operate at the frontier of physical AI and computer vision. We are not selling off‑the‑shelf software. Every client engagement is bespoke, research‑heavy and technically deep. Our deals sit in the range of low to mid seven figures and our buyers are computer vision engineers, heads of AI, R&D directors and VP Product at companies like Apple, Samsung, Meta and global beauty enterprises. We are expanding commercially and need someone who has been in this world before.
THE ROLE
You will own Lumirithmic's commercial pipeline end‑to‑end. This is a hunting role. You will be responsible for identifying, engaging and qualifying enterprise accounts in the computer vision, XR, AR/VR, spatial data, 3D capture and camera AI space across the US and UK markets. You will build the outbound motion from scratch, work directly with a technical team who joins mid‑funnel, and own the relationship through to signed contract. This is not account management. This is not managing warm inbound. This is cold‑to‑close enterprise sales in a niche, technically complex category where your sector knowledge is what gets you in the room.
